What Is The Average Cost For Travertine Cleaning in Wharley End?

Grasping the average cost of Travertine cleaning is essential for successful budget management of your restoration project.

On average, you should budget for between £25.00 and £45.00 per square meter for Travertine cleaning.

The ultimate price depends on various considerations.

These include the size of the area, the condition of the Travertine, and the complexity of the needed work.

Should your Travertine show stains, cracks, or missing grout, the price could go up.

The initial step in the cleaning process is inspecting your travertine floors to ensure you receive the most accurate estimate.

Our inspection will include looking for holes, cracks, and areas lacking grout.

This meticulous inspection provides insight into the needs of your floors.

Unleash the True Beauty of Your Floors with Travertine Cleaning

Our travertine cleaning process leaves floors looking polished and revitalised.

We use tough scrubbing machines and suitable cleaners to remove all traces of dirt and sealer residue.

After scrubbing, we use hot-water pressure rinsing to thoroughly cleanse the surface.

We use appropriate resin or cement fillers to repair any holes, cracks, or missing grout in your travertine.

The recommended cleaning schedule for travertine is every six to twelve months, depending on how it's used. Regular cleaning helps maintain its beauty and extends its lifespan, giving you the freedom to enjoy your space worry-free.

It's possible to clean travertine using everyday products, but proceed with caution. Vinegar and other acidic cleaners can damage travertine, so they should be avoided. Stick with pH-neutral cleaners and always test a small area to be safe.

Indeed, travertine's resilience and ability to withstand weather make it appropriate for exterior applications. It supplies a beautiful aesthetic while standing up to multiple elements, enabling you to appreciate your outdoor spaces without worrying about wear.

Travertine cleaning generally takes a day or two, contingent on the space's dimensions and state. You'll observe changes promptly, but it's recommended to allow the sealer ample time to set fully following the process.
